How Much Money Is Spent On Mental Health In Australia?

How Much Money Is Spent On Mental Health In Australia? $6.7 billion was spent on state/territory mental health services in 2019–20; $2.9b on public hospital services; $2.6b on community services. $1.4 billion, or $53 per Australian, was spent by the Australian Government on benefits for Medicare-subsidised mental health-specific services in 2019–20. How Much Does It Cost Get A Mental Health Diagnosis?

How Much Does It Cost Get A Mental Health Diagnosis? Most psychiatrists charge between $100 and $300 for each appointment, or slightly more for an initial intake session. How Often Do Doctors Get Treated For Mental Health?

How Often Do Doctors Get Treated For Mental Health? In most healthcare systems (whether privately or publicly funded), and across all ages, genders, specialties and seniority, doctors have higher rates of depression and anxiety compared with the general population and other professional groups.
